Abstract
In this paper, with introduction of microeconomics and genetic engineering knowledge, a job assignment method for grid computing is proposed, considering both time limit and cost simultaneously. It determines resource trading price between resource buyer and resource provider based on auction model, and then finds the optimal job assignment solution based on genetic algorithm. Simulation results have shown that the proposed method is both feasible and effective
